News: Everything changes, everything stays the same…

Over the last three and a bit years bh one has continually evolved, expanding into areas beyond our original ideas. Our Live nights have long been established, and Honey Be Records is now on the verge of releasing new material by Deltorers and Matt Marr, with a new Sables long-player also nearing completion. Recently we were asked to manage the bookings and promotion at Champions, a role that has now been expanded. Bearing in mind bh one is largely maintained and updated by one person (with much needed and appreciated tech help...) our focus over the coming weeks will primarily be on Champions, as well as our upcoming releases on Honey Be Records.

bh one may have added new features over the last three years, but its layout has generally remained the same. It remains easy to use and has served its purpose superbly, but it's looking 'tired', and we're basically tired of using it. Throughout September, with our focus away from the website, we will effectively be taking a 'month off' from online updates, though we intend to return with a completely new look for the site. Amongst other new features the new site will be far more interactive (podcasts etc), potentially allowing easy access by other contributors. A provisional relaunch date is 1 October, though as with anything technical this is subject to change.

Meanwhile we intend to further devour the fantastic new album by Tim Berry's Oh Dreamland, and hopefully find time to visit one of the many local festivals taking place in the area. We apologise to anyone who uses bh one to keep abreast of local music news, and hope you'll enjoy the new site when it becomes live.
